Beyond the license, the platform dives deep into the technical security measures a casino employs. This is where details matter. They check for and explain the importance of 128-bit or 256-bit SSL (Secure Socket Layer) encryption, which is the same technology used by banks to ensure that all data transmitted between your device and the casino’s server—like your personal information and financial details—is completely encrypted and inaccessible to third parties. They also assess the casino’s policies on data privacy and storage, confirming whether they adhere to regulations like the GDPR, which indicates a serious commitment to protecting user data even for players outside the EU.

Another critical angle is game fairness and software provider reputation. A casino can have a great license and strong encryption, but if the games are rigged, the player loses. The 3z platform investigates the casino’s game library, identifying the software developers they partner with, such as NetEnt, Play’n GO, Pragmatic Play, and Evolution Gaming. These providers are renowned for having their games regularly tested and certified by independent auditing firms like eCOGRA, iTech Labs, and Gaming Laboratories International (GLI). These audits verify the Random Number Generator (RNG) integrity, ensuring that every spin of a slot or deal of a card is truly random and fair. The platform often highlights the certified RTP (Return to Player) percentages for games, giving you a clear expectation of potential payouts over the long term. For example, they might point out that a specific slot from a reputable provider has a published RTP of 96.5%, which is verified and not just a marketing claim.

They teach you what to look for: the presence of a license number (usually in the website footer), clear terms and conditions, accessible customer support channels, and information on responsible gambling tools like deposit limits and self-exclusion.
